视觉编程零基础学什么内容

fiy 其他 34

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    视觉编程是一种通过图形界面进行编程的方法,它允许用户使用可视化工具来创建程序,而无需编写传统的代码。对于零基础学习视觉编程,以下是一些内容建议:

    1. 学习基本编程概念:即使是视觉编程,也需要理解一些基本的编程概念,例如变量、条件语句、循环和函数等。学习这些基础知识将帮助你更好地理解和应用视觉编程工具。

    2. 掌握视觉编程工具:选择一种流行的视觉编程工具,如Scratch、Blockly或MIT App Inventor等。通过学习这些工具的使用方法,你可以了解如何创建和控制图形对象、添加交互和动画效果,并利用工具提供的各种功能进行程序设计。

    3. 理解事件驱动编程:视觉编程通常是基于事件驱动的,即通过响应用户的操作或系统事件来触发程序执行特定的操作。学习如何使用事件来控制程序的流程和行为是视觉编程的重要内容。

    4. 实践项目:通过完成一些简单的视觉编程项目来巩固所学内容。例如,创建一个简单的游戏、制作一个交互式故事或设计一个简单的应用程序等。通过实际动手实践,你可以更好地理解视觉编程的实际应用和技巧。

    5. 深入学习高级功能:一旦掌握了基本的视觉编程技巧,你可以进一步学习和探索更高级的功能。例如,学习如何使用传感器、网络通信、数据库等进行更复杂的程序设计。

    总而言之,零基础学习视觉编程需要掌握基本的编程概念、学习视觉编程工具的使用方法,理解事件驱动编程原理,并通过实践项目来巩固所学内容。随着学习的深入,你可以进一步学习和探索更高级的视觉编程技巧和功能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    视觉编程是一种通过图形化界面进行编程的方法,它允许用户使用图形化元素和连接线来创建程序,而无需编写传统的文本代码。对于零基础学习视觉编程,以下是一些内容建议:

    1. 理解基本概念:首先,你需要了解视觉编程的基本概念和术语。这包括理解图形化界面中的各种元素(如控件、事件、变量等)以及它们之间的连接方式。

    2. 学习流程控制:流程控制是编程中的基本概念,它指导程序按照特定的顺序执行不同的操作。在视觉编程中,你需要学习如何使用条件语句(如if-else语句)和循环语句(如for循环和while循环)来控制程序的流程。

    3. 掌握事件处理:视觉编程常常涉及到与用户交互,因此你需要学习如何处理各种事件。这包括学习如何触发事件、如何编写事件处理程序以及如何响应用户的操作。

    4. 理解变量和数据类型:在视觉编程中,你需要学习如何使用变量来存储和操作数据。你需要理解不同的数据类型(如整数、浮点数、字符串等)以及如何声明和使用变量。

    5. 学习调试技巧:在编程过程中,调试是一个重要的技能。你需要学习如何识别和修复程序中的错误。视觉编程通常提供了一些调试工具和功能,你需要学习如何使用它们来诊断和解决问题。

    除了以上内容,你还可以学习其他与视觉编程相关的主题,如图形界面设计、用户体验设计等。此外,参与视觉编程社区和项目,与其他视觉编程爱好者交流和分享经验也是提高技能的好方法。最重要的是,不断实践和尝试,通过实际项目来巩固所学知识。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    视觉编程是一种通过图形化界面进行编程的方法,它允许用户使用图形元素、拖拽操作和连接线条来创建程序,而不需要编写传统的代码。对于零基础的学习者来说,以下是一些建议的内容,可以帮助你入门视觉编程:

    1. 计算机基础知识:了解计算机的工作原理、操作系统、文件系统等基本概念,这将帮助你更好地理解视觉编程工具的运行环境。

    2. 视觉编程工具的选择:选择一种适合初学者的视觉编程工具,常见的工具有Scratch、Blockly等。这些工具通常具有友好的界面和简单的操作方式,适合初学者入门。

    3. 学习界面元素和操作:学习如何使用视觉编程工具中的界面元素,如图形块、按钮、文本框等,以及如何进行拖拽、连接等基本操作。

    4. 理解控制流程:学习如何使用视觉编程工具中的控制流程,如循环、条件判断等。掌握这些概念可以帮助你组织程序的执行顺序和逻辑。

    5. 学习变量和数据类型:了解变量的概念和使用方法,学习不同的数据类型,如整数、浮点数、字符串等。这些是编程中常用的基本概念。

    6. 探索事件和交互:学习如何使用视觉编程工具中的事件,如鼠标点击、键盘输入等,以及如何对用户的交互做出响应。这样可以使你的程序具有更好的交互性。

    7. 实践项目:在学习的过程中,尝试完成一些简单的项目,如制作一个动画、游戏等。通过实践,你可以将所学的知识应用到实际问题中,并提升自己的编程能力。

    8. 参考文档和教程:查阅相关的文档和教程,了解更多关于视觉编程的知识和技巧。这些资源可以帮助你解决问题,提供更多的学习资料。

    总之,视觉编程是一种适合初学者入门的编程方法,通过学习基本概念和操作,实践项目,并查阅相关文档和教程,你可以逐步掌握视觉编程的技巧,提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部